引言
表单是网站和应用程序中不可或缺的组成部分,它用于收集用户输入的数据。随着前端技术的发展,表单前端开发工具也日益丰富,为开发者提供了更多高效、便捷的解决方案。本文将深入探讨表单前端开发工具,帮助开发者轻松打造高效互动的表单,解锁前端设计新境界。
一、表单前端开发工具概述
1.1 工具类型
目前,表单前端开发工具主要分为以下几类:
- 表单构建器:提供可视化界面,方便开发者快速搭建表单。
- 表单库:提供一系列可复用的表单组件,开发者可根据需求进行组合。
- 表单框架:提供完整的表单解决方案,包括表单设计、验证、提交等功能。
1.2 工具特点
- 易用性:操作简单,降低开发门槛。
- 灵活性:支持自定义样式和功能。
- 可扩展性:方便与其他前端技术整合。
- 跨平台:支持多种浏览器和设备。
二、常用表单前端开发工具
2.1 Bootstrap Form
Bootstrap Form 是基于 Bootstrap 框架的表单组件库,提供丰富的表单样式和布局。其特点如下:
- 响应式设计:适应不同屏幕尺寸。
- 丰富的样式:支持多种表单控件和布局。
- 易于集成:与 Bootstrap 其他组件无缝衔接。
2.2 jQuery Validation Plugin
jQuery Validation Plugin 是一款流行的表单验证插件,提供丰富的验证规则和提示信息。其特点如下:
- 易于使用:通过简单的配置即可实现表单验证。
- 丰富的验证规则:支持日期、邮箱、电话等多种验证类型。
- 自定义提示信息:提高用户体验。
2.3 React Formik
React Formik 是一款基于 React 的表单管理库,提供表单状态管理、表单验证等功能。其特点如下:
- React 生态:与 React 组件无缝集成。
- 易于使用:通过链式调用 API 实现表单管理。
- 灵活的验证:支持自定义验证规则。
2.4 Vue.js VeeValidate
Vue.js VeeValidate 是一款基于 Vue.js 的表单验证库,提供丰富的验证规则和组件。其特点如下:
- Vue.js 生态:与 Vue.js 组件无缝集成。
- 易于使用:通过简单的配置即可实现表单验证。
- 丰富的组件:支持日期、邮箱、电话等多种验证类型。
三、打造高效互动表单的技巧
3.1 简化表单设计
- 减少表单项数量:只包含必要的表单项。
- 合理布局:遵循用户操作习惯,提高易用性。
3.2 提供实时反馈
- 表单验证:实时显示错误信息,引导用户正确填写。
- 加载动画:提高用户体验,避免长时间等待。
3.3 优化表单提交
- 异步提交:避免页面刷新,提高用户体验。
- 错误处理:提供详细的错误信息,方便用户修改。
四、总结
表单前端开发工具为开发者提供了丰富的解决方案,帮助开发者轻松打造高效互动的表单。通过选择合适的工具和遵循一定的设计原则,开发者可以解锁前端设计新境界,为用户提供更好的使用体验。
